Adorable footage has shown a faithful owl making nightly visits to the man who saved its life and nursed it back to health.

Tiberius, a Tawny owl, was found starving on a military barracks parade ground in Plymouth by animal lover Mark Foden in June 2024.

The retired 63-year-old formed a special bond with the bird – who he named after Star Trek character ‘Captain James Tiberius Kirk’ – after spending months looking after it.

Mr Foden, of Devon, has now shared heartwarming outdoor Ring camera footage of Tiberius returning to his rescuer every night.

He said: ‘He was very emaciated I think and had not been fed for a while, so he was on his way out.

‘At first he wouldn’t eat, it was very difficult to feed, he wouldn’t take it himself so I had to put it in his mouth and push it down but as you can see, he grew into a fine fellow!’

Tiberius wasn’t the first bird Mr Foden has saved and released into the wild. In June 2018, he found an injured jackdaw with a damaged wing in his back garden.

Speaking about the moment he set Tiberius free, the animal lover said: ‘When I released [him], I just opened the door and I filmed it. At first he was quite resistant – he thought this is a bit odd and he kept coming back and forwards. Eventually he leaned over and he flew out and then he disappeared.

‘And then 12 days later, I just looked on the Ring app and he’s sitting there and I thought, oh, wow, this is good!’

Despite releasing the owl back into the wild, Mr Foden captures sightings of Tiberius returning home almost every night.

He hopes Tiberius will one day establish a territory, but continue to stay in the vicinity.

Mr Foden makes the most of his multiple cameras’ night vision, monitoring Tiberius and other wildlife that visit his garden.
